Wendy T. Behary is a LCSW. Wendy has over 25 years of professional experience and is the founder and director of The Cognitive Therapy Center of New Jersey. She has been supervising therapists for more than 20 years. Wendy trained and worked with Dr. Jeffrey Young at the Cognitive Therapy Center and the Schema Therapy Institute of New York. Wendy is a consulting supervisor for The Academy of Cognitive Therapy. She served as the President of the Executive Board of the International Society of Schema Therapy from 2010-2014 and is currently the chair of the Schema Therapy Development Programs Sub-Committee for the ISST.
Wendy has co-authored several chapters and articles. She is the author of a book. It’s called Disarming the Narcissist. There are 12 languages for the New Harbinger, 2nd edition. Wendy deals with people who live with and deal with narcissists. She is an expert on the subject of narcissism and is a contributing chapter author of several chapters.
